Their bagels are not New York style. They're boiled but not in sweet water; put in an oven but not a wood fire, so they are less sweet and less dense than New York bagels. The sesame bagel was decent. Apricot Rugelach was a small, almost bite-sized pastry made with cream cheese. It was good.
